The Marseille SIRIC, which IPC is part of together with AP-HM, supports the emergence of innovative projects through specific call for proposals. The first call for emerging projects was launched on January 31st 2014 and closed on March 25th 2104. A budget of 200 000€ was devoted to this call to fund innovative projects in the field of translational research on breast cancer, pancreatic cancer, glioma or leukemia. 15 projects were received and submitted for review by the international scientific advisory board of the SIRIC and by the scientific committee of the SIRIC, and 5 projects were selected for funding.
